Construction Cost Overview for Aberdeen, SD

Construction and renovation costs in Aberdeen, SD reflect the city's cost of living index of 90 and a material cost index of 81 (where 100 represents the national baseline). With an average construction labor rate of $23.34 per hour and a median home price of $209,205, homeowners in Aberdeen should plan their renovation budgets carefully using local pricing data.

Aberdeen sits in IECC Climate Zone 6 (Cold), which influences insulation requirements, HVAC sizing, and overall material choices for both new construction and remodeling projects. Low seismic risk — standard building codes apply. The median household income of $48,491 in Aberdeen means that a mid-range kitchen remodel at $28,000 represents approximately 58% of annual household income.

Building permits in Aberdeen average $742, varying by project scope and local building department requirements. Major renovations involving structural, electrical, or plumbing work require permits in virtually all South Dakota jurisdictions. Scheduling projects during off-peak seasons can save 5-15% on labor costs as contractors have greater availability.

How much does a kitchen remodel cost in Aberdeen, SD?
A mid-range kitchen remodel in Aberdeen, SD costs approximately $28,000 on average. Budget renovations start around $19,600, while premium remodels with custom cabinetry and high-end appliances can reach $42,000 or more. Labor rates in Aberdeen average $23.34/hour for general construction work.
What is the average construction labor rate in Aberdeen?
Construction labor in Aberdeen, SD averages $23.34 per hour. This is 20% below the national average. Specialized trades like licensed electricians and master plumbers typically charge 25-45% more than general construction labor rates.
Do I need a building permit for home renovations in Aberdeen?
Most significant renovations in Aberdeen, SD require building permits. Permit costs average around $742 depending on project scope. Projects involving structural changes, electrical rewiring, plumbing modifications, or additions almost always require permits. Cosmetic updates like interior painting, replacing fixtures, or installing new flooring typically do not.
How does Aberdeen's cost of living affect construction costs?
Aberdeen has a cost of living index of 90 (national average = 100), which directly impacts construction costs. Higher cost of living means higher labor rates, material delivery costs, and permit fees. The material cost index in Aberdeen is 81, reflecting local supply chain dynamics and demand levels.
